Q1:I think of knitting an everyday normal person activity like reading or watching TV, so I don't think fame makes sense here. It's more of a nesting type of activity? Make your house your own... but fame, not so much. People who knit have long been known for making things for EVERYBODY they know, so I think it would make sense for them to be able to make university-themed and club-themed items for University and Get Together. And definitely yarn for cats, my cat would steal a skein and drag it all over the house for me to find abandoned in random places. That would probably get too annoying in game form, so just a Play interaction would be nice.
Q2: I would be fine with crocheting too, I would actually love it. Creativity often leads you to more creativity, and then can sometimes lead you completely astray, so actually it would fit. Learning one thing often inspires you to leap down other rabbit holes, so if it were to unlock later on (say at level 6), that would actually be really realistic. Variety is the spice of life, or creativity at least. Would love to see some crocheted items in addition to knitting.
Q3: I would imagine the desk could be useful for adding finishing touches like attaching other decorative pieces or ribbons or little plastic eyes or whatever. My understanding it that finished knitted items are supposed to be washed and laid flat to dry, and while you couldn't reasonably do the hand washing interaction, maybe it could be left laid flat there as sort of an implied drying table when it was complete, as a nice little touch.
Q4: Anything more than a full sims week for the largest item would probably feel like too long. So I would say a week for an afghan or rug, then half that for sweater type things, and half again for the next size down, and so on.
Q5: If the alternative is not being able to knit at all rather than sitting, then yes, whatever keeps them knitting. I don't want any impediments or inconveniences when I'm trying to get something done. But please don't jog halfway down the block to find a park bench if there's not chair within a certain radius, just stand until directed to do otherwise.
Q6: In the Sims 3 when you use the Tutor animation, you can see the teacher Sim explaining, and then the learner Sim going... yes, uh huh, ok.... oh now I get it! Like this, right? I'd like to be able to see it like that.
Q7: Honestly, I have no experience with Etsy. But maybe sell through he mailbox like we do with writing and music? It would actually fit for this. Or we could click an option that says "Donate to homeless" and you could see a homeless Sim sleeping on a bench somewhere that when you hover over their sweater, it says it was made by you. You could clothe the world! Maybe apply that to other sorts of things too? Potholders for everyone! (Not actually potholder, but you know what I mean). And if you wanted to make a save where eventually all of the townies ended up wearing irritating sweaters and marching around doing the swangry stomp ...... you could do that >:)
Q8: Please make there be options to avoid negative effects for those of us who just want to enjoy wearing the sweaters without having to worry about it. Being able to wear and enjoy them is the whole point here, after all, isn't it? For some people, anyway. But if I wanted to torture a Sim with a bad sweater, I would like to see a hotheaded Sim eventually really lose it if the sweater didn't go away.
Q9: I need your best Knitting puns. Feed them to me.
I got no funny, sorry. Stop needling me!
Q10: Talk about knitting autonomously, yes, but just like in real life don't force it on others who may not want it to happen. A person who knows a fanatical knitter and hears about it enough might get a little jump on learning if/when they choose to start, because they've already heard so much about it. But that would be about as far as I would take it. This should be absolutely player choice and player directed ONLY. Player choice should always be absolutely sacred in things like this in my opinion.
